Sandown Park came alive with pumpkins on Nov 1st
Halloween night was cold, windy and wet. What a relief to have it dry up in time for our pumpkin parade!
We had a number of pumpkins arrive before 6 and by the time we were ready to start, we had a good turn out!
Why do we host a Pumpkin Parade? It’s a chance for us to meet the community in a community-built event. It’s about sharing and admiring people’s creations, seeing kids play with new and old friends and sometimes we’re lucky enough to see a second go-round of costumes!
